MET Institute of Post Graduate Diploma in Management has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
CoursesEligibility
MBA/PGDMCandidates must have passed with minimum of mentioned marks (45% marks in case of candidates belonging to reserved category) in aggregate in any Bachelor's Degree of minimum 3years duration (in any discipline) from an university recognised by the Association of Indian Universities. Those who are appearing for final year/semester examination can also apply. However, they must produce documentary evidence of having passed the examination, on or before the commencement of the programme failing which their admission will be liable for cancellation. Proficiency in MS Office is a prerequisite.

Maharani Lakshmi Ammanni College for Women has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
CoursesEligibility
B.VocA candidate who has passed two years of Pre-University Examination conducted by the Pre-University Education Board in the State of Karnataka or any other examination considered as Equivalent thereto by Bangalore University shall be eligible for this program. The candidate should have also studied Chemistry and Biology in +2 level.
B.Sc.Candid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ognised school/board.
BBACandid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ognised school/board.
CertificateCandidate must have passed 10+2 from any recognised board.
UG DiplomaCandidate must have passed 10+2 from a recognised board.
PG DiplomaCandidate must have passed 10+2 from a recognised board.
B.A.For all the UG programs inHumanities, a candidate who has passed thetwo year Pre-University Examinations conducted by the Karnataka Pre-University Education Board or any other examination considered as equivalent thereto shall be eligible for admission.
M.A.Candidate must have passed with 40% marks in the aggregate of all subjects and mentioned marks in B.A./B.Sc./B.Com./BBA/BCA. Graduates who have secured at least 55% marks in the Language Kannada in the degree course are also eligible.
M.Sc.Candidates who are currently appearing for the graduation exam are also eligible to apply for M.Sc in Biotechnology. In such a case, they have to clear it before the finalization of the admission process.
B.ComA candidate who has passed the two years Pre-University Examinations conducted by the Karnataka Pre-University Education Board or any other examination considered as equivalent thereto shall be eligible for admission. The candidate should have studied both Business Studies and Accountancy in the qualifying examination.
M.ComCandidate must have B.Com/B.B.M or equivalent with mentioned marks in the aggregate in commerce subjects from any recognised university.
BCACandid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ognised school/board.

Division of Biological Sciences, Indian Institute of Science has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
CoursesEligibility
B.Sc.Candidates who have completed their 10+2 (or equivalent) examination in 2022 and also those who are expecting to complete their 10+2 (or equivalent) examination in 2023.
The candidates must have studied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ics as main subjects in their qualifying exam along with any other subjects.
The candidates must have secured a firstclass or mentioned marks or equivalent grade (relaxed to pass class for SC/ST candidates) in the qualifying examination (i.e., 10+2 or equivalent)

AIM College of law has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
CoursesEligibility
B.Com LL.BCandidate must have passed the Higher Secondary Examination of the board of higher secondary education Kerala or any other examination recognised by the Universities in Kerala or equivalent.
Candidate must have passed the qualifying examination with a minimum of 45% marks. Candidate belonging to socially and educationally backward classes need 42% and for SC/ST 40%.
Candidate who have obtained +2 Higher Secondary pass certificate or first degree certificate after prosecuting studies in distance or correspondence method can also apply.
Candidate who have obtained 10 +2 or graduation/post-graduation through open universities system directly without having any basic qualification for prosecuting such studies are not eligible for admission.
Candidate must have completed 17 years of age, as on 31.12.2021.
Candidate who are appearing/appeared for the qualifying examination are also eligible to apply on provisional basis.
